Inspecting Tools Prior To Rental



Before proceeding with the rental agreement, a thorough assessment of the tools is critical to guarantee its functionality and security for your project. Begin by visually taking a look at the equipment for any kind of indications of damage, such as leakages, damages, or splits. Examine all relocating components to guarantee they operate efficiently and without uncommon sounds. Check any kind of digital parts to ensure they function correctly - aerial lift rental. Additionally, inspect the security functions, such as emergency situation shut-off switches or security guards, to ensure they remain in location and functioning effectively.


Do not fail to remember to examine the equipment's upkeep documents to verify that it has actually been effectively serviced and depends on date with any called for assessments. If feasible, ask the rental company for a presentation on just how to operate the equipment securely. Take note of any type of pre-existing damages and guarantee it is documented in the rental arrangement to stay clear of being held liable for it upon return. By performing a thorough inspection before renting out devices, you can reduce the risk of unforeseen issues during your job.
